Set Style Matters: Bezel Options, Metals, and Comfort
The setting you choose shapes both the look and the feel of your ring, especially when you’re working with coloured stones. A bezel engagement ring style encircles the gemstone with a metal rim, which can protect the stone’s edges and create a sleek, modern silhouette. Bezel engagement ring This design often sits securely against the finger, making it a practical choice for people who want comfort and peace of mind. It can also emphasize colour by providing a clean frame that keeps attention on the stone.
Consider how the band metal will interact with the gemstone’s hue. Yellow gold can intensify warmth in many coloured stones, while white gold or platinum-style metals can create a brighter, cooler contrast. Pay attention to profile height as well, since a higher setting can catch on clothing or hair more easily. If you prefer a refined everyday look, look for a smooth interior finish and a balanced proportion between stone size and band width.
Plan for Quality, Sourcing, and Fit
Before you commit, evaluate the gemstone’s quality factors with clear expectations. Ask about the cut, since even a beautiful stone can lose brilliance if the proportions aren’t balanced. Inclusions and colour zoning should be described in plain terms, so you know exactly what you’re buying rather than relying on guesswork. For coloured stones, confirm whether the colour is natural or treated, and how that affects long-term appearance and care.
Fit is equally important, because a ring that looks right but feels awkward won’t be worn consistently. Start by checking your ring size with a reliable method, especially if you’re buying as a surprise or through a custom process. Decide whether the band should be snug or slightly adjustable, and consider comfort features such as rounded edges and a smooth underside. If your lifestyle includes frequent typing, sports, or travel, prioritize secure settings and comfortable band thickness.
